Features Compared
Gamma and Otter.ai operate in distinctly different spaces within the AI tools ecosystem, each solving fundamentally different problems. Gamma is an AI-powered presentation and document builder that excels at rapid deck creation—you input a prompt and receive a polished presentation in seconds, complete with smart templates and the ability to embed rich media like videos and live data. The platform includes built-in analytics to track presentation views and supports exports to PDF and PPTX. Otter.ai, by contrast, is a meeting assistant focused on capturing and processing what happens during calls. It delivers real-time meeting transcription, speaker identification, auto-generated summaries, and automatic action item extraction. Otter.ai also offers OtterPilot, an autonomous meeting attendance feature that attends calls on your behalf.
The strengths of each are non-overlapping. Gamma shines for teams and professionals who need to communicate ideas visually and quickly—the AI generation speed and beautiful templates out-of-the-box eliminate hours of design work. Otter.ai's unique value lies in eliminating post-meeting friction: users save hours on administrative tasks like transcription, note-taking, and action item tracking. However, both tools have trade-offs. Gamma offers less granular control than traditional tools like PowerPoint or Keynote, and branding customization is limited on the free plan. Otter.ai's transcription accuracy can degrade with heavy accents or industry-specific jargon, and its AI summaries occasionally miss important nuance in complex discussions.

Ease of Use & Onboarding
Gamma prioritizes speed and simplicity: users enter a prompt and receive a presentation ready for refinement or immediate sharing. This low-friction approach means non-technical users can produce professional output within minutes. Otter.ai requires slightly more setup—users must grant access to their calendar or meeting platform and configure which meetings to transcribe—but once configured, it operates passively and invisibly. The onboarding experience favors different user types: Gamma appeals to those who want instant creative output, while Otter.ai suits users comfortable with background automation who value not having to think about note-taking. Both tools have strong free tiers that enable hands-on exploration without commitment, reducing perceived risk for first-time users.

Who Should Choose Gamma?
Gamma is the right choice for marketing teams, sales professionals, educators, and anyone who regularly needs to create and present decks under time pressure. A product manager who must turn quarterly data into a board presentation, a startup founder pitching investors, or a trainer designing course materials will all find enormous value in Gamma's speed and template quality. Small teams without dedicated designers particularly benefit from Gamma's ability to produce publication-ready decks without external resources. If your bottleneck is presentation creation and polish rather than meeting management, Gamma eliminates friction and frees your team to focus on content rather than formatting.
Who Should Choose Otter.ai?
Otter.ai is essential for meeting-heavy roles—customer success managers, sales professionals, product managers, recruiters, and anyone attending 5+ calls per week. Teams that struggle with action item follow-up, lost context from calls, or inconsistent note quality will recover the most value. Otter.ai also suits distributed teams where call attendees are scattered across time zones and someone needs a reliable record. The speaker identification and CRM integration features make it particularly valuable for sales teams and customer-facing organizations. If your pain point is administrative overhead after meetings rather than content creation before them, Otter.ai is the strategic choice.
